ApneaBase.org Ranking was built to help freedivers getting better, and more complete overview and analysis of their performances. It contains not only data from the official AIDA Result Register, but also from many other sources: Freedive Central, Apnea Mania, FFESSM, CMAS, FIPSAS, F.R.E.E., and also directly from competition organizers. Currently it contains 43807 performances from 877 freediving competitions, and many hundreds of individual records attempts. Data from external sources was not blindly imported, but carefully analyzed, and many duplicate entries, misspellings, false name assignments, and other discrepancies were removed. Besides others, 2791 duplicate and misspelled names of competitors were fixed. Redundant data from several sources helped correcting many mistakes, corrupted, and incomplete data.

The system of ranking offers many different reports - from official ranking, over ranking combining data from AIDA, together with data of other AIDA competitions from other sources, to ranking including national, local, or unofficial competitions, and even performances from competitions of other organizations (for example the CMAS or the FFESSM). Besides the usual global rankings per discipline, there are also many other types of reports, including some that were done just for fun, or to feed data and statistics junkies like myself. So you can find reports based on the total time spent in apnea; the total distance swam under water (both vertically and horizontally), ranking by number of blackouts, and disqualifications; ranking using dynamically adjusted point values; and many others. And then, each of the reports can be run not only in the global scope, but also on continental, regional, national, local, or club level. And you can also compare continents, regions, nations, cities, clubs, or federations among each other.
